Clusters are generated by partitioning the above graphs into strongly connected and weakly connected subgraphs. Large subgraphs are broken down using the Louvain Community Detection Algorithm, providing more refined results and eliminating Sybil addresses more accurately. Blockchain can be used to ... WebAug 18, 2024 · SYBIL ATTACK ESSENTIALS. An attack against peer-to-peer networks, such as blockchains. The attacker creates multiple fake identities to gain influence in the network. Proof of work is an efficient means of preventing a Sybil attack. Reserve requirements, trusted validators and other solutions render a Sybil attack ineffective.
